4 Ways to Make Your Guest Room More Inviting

With the holidays quickly approaching, getting your guest room and bath gussied up should be on the top of your priority list if you are hosting family or friends now or in the new year.

From essential items to items that are more fancy and fun, these tips are sure to make your guests feel warm and cozy in your home.

Clean and Inviting Environment Adding things like scented candles and a fresh floral arrangement will put your guests at ease while making them feel extra welcomed to your home - plus, they are fun elements to include to showcase your personal style. Presenting a clean and organized environment will make your guests feel the room was designed specifically with them in mind!

Welcome Basket Right before your guests are set to arrive, place a beautifully curated welcome basket on the foot of the bed. Include fun things like a lifestyle magazine, sweet treats, and an item that can be used during one of your upcoming outings (think a beach towel if you are headed to the pool or beach!) and essentials like extra bars of soap, and a beautiful printable of the Wifi password. If you live in a city or state in which your guests are not from, try including local items such as locally made honey, a community paper, or an item your state is known for (i.e. a basket of oranges if your home is in Florida). If you have a guest bathroom as well, including toiletry essentials such as small bottles of shampoo, conditioner, and cotton balls can be a great addition to your welcome basket for an overall comfortable stay.

Organized Linen Closet An organized closet in your guest room will make your guests feel more welcome. Include extra pillows, throw blankets, and linens to make your guests feel extra comfy. Having things readily and easily accessible for your guests such as towels, an iron and ironing board, and a surface to unpack their belongings will give them a more boutique hotel feel. Make sure to leave extra hangers in your closet for delicate items to be hung - this is a small note, but one your guests will appreciate as they are getting ready for one of the fun activities on your itinerary together!

Beverage Cart Add a dash of fun and excitement by including a cart or table with beverages. A styled beverage cart including things like bottled water, snacks, and cocktails will make your guests feel more comfortable by having light snacks on hand in their room rather than having to feel intrusive when looking through the main pantry in the kitchen.
